The deadly 2011 tornado in Joplin, Missouri, forever changed not only residents’ lives, but also the structures they call home. On May 22, 2011, an EF-5 tornado struck the town of Joplin, Missouri, leaving a trail of destruction in its wake. On May 22, 2011, an EF5 tornado tore through Joplin, Missouri, killing 161 people and causing over 1,000 injuries as the powerful storm destroyed over 2,000 buildings, making it the deadliest single tornado on record in the U.S. ![]() The May 22, 2011, Joplin tornado, caused 161 fatalities and more than 1,000 injuries, making it the deadliest single tornado on record in the U.S. Track: generally West to East across Joplin (Newton and Jasper counties) 8,000 structures damaged or destroyed (30 of Joplin) 162 fatalities, >1,000 injuries (Joplin Population: 49,024) Sources: National Weather Service (NWS),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A), City of Joplin Joplin Tornado Overview Source: NOAA. ![]()
